Tony Stewart Enters the Rumble In Ft. Wayne Midget Racing Event
FORT WAYNE, Ind. – NASCAR Sprint Cup Series (NSCS) star Tony Stewart has entered the famous Munchkin for the two-day Rumble in Ft. Wayne event. The event will be held Friday, Dec. 26, and Saturday, Dec. 27, at the Allen County Memorial Coliseum Expo Center, located at 4000 Parnell Avenue, Ft. Wayne, Ind. The event features the Rumble Series Midgets, 600cc Winged Modified Midgets, go-karts, junior sprints and the Lucas Oil Quarter Midgets. Stewart, a two-time NSCS champion, won the midget feature on the final night of the 2007 event and has visited victory lane four times since 2005. Billy Wease of Noblesville, Ind., won the opening night. Stewart, who hails from Columbus, Ind., won his first Rumble in Ft. Ryan Newman Foundation Raises $155,000 for Animal Welfare
STATESVILLE, N.C. – NASCAR Sprint Cup Series Driver Ryan Newman raised $155,000 for conservation and animal welfare efforts at the Ryan Newman Foundation’s Fourth Annual Charity Gala and Auction on December 12 and the Third Annual Charity Fishing Tournament on December 13 in Mooresville, NC. The gala, which was presented by Alltel Wireless, featured a concert by country music singers/songwriters Bridgette Tatum and Danny Myrick. The pair wrote the song “She’s Country,” which was performed by Jason Aldean on the 2008 Country Music Awards. The charity bass tournament was presented by Ranger Boats and facilitated by FLW Outdoors. Three hundred and nineteen fishermen competed for the grand prize which was Ryan Newman’s Z-20 Ranger Boat equipped with a 225 H.O.
